2021-6-29 · Description Alexa Fluor™ 647 is a bright and photostable far-red dye with excitation ideally suited to the 633 nm laser line. Used for stable signal generation in imaging and flow cytometry Alexa Fluor™ 647 dye is water soluble and pH-insensitive from pH 4 to pH 10.

Alexa Fluor 555 Tyramide Reagent is a component of SuperBoost™ tyramide signal amplification kits now available separately. This reagent can be used with any antibody conjugated to HRP for tyramide signal amplification for detection of low abundance targets in multiplexable fluorescent immunocytochemistry (ICC) immunohistochemistry (IHC) and in situ hybridization (ISH).

The Click-iT EdU Alexa Fluor 647 Imaging Kit provides a superior alternative to BrdU assays for measuring cell proliferation. EdU (5-ethynyl-2 -deoxyuridine) is a nucleoside analog of thymidine and is incorporated into DNA during active DNA synthesis. Alexa Fluor 647 conjugate of WGA exhibits the bright red fluorescence of the Alexa Fluor 647 dye (excitation/emission maxima bsim650/668nm). Alexa Fluor 647 WGA binds to sialic acid and N-acetylglucosaminyl residues.

Invitrogen Alexa Fluor 350 dye is a blue-fluorescent dye with moderate photostability and excitation that matches the 350 nm laser line. The brightness and photostability of blue dyes are best suited to direct imaging of high-abundance targets.
